Kate's first gay press interview!

Since her eviction, Kate has received wide-spread media coverage over her anti-gay comments. queerplanet was given the opportunity to chat with Kate about the "I'm a homophobic" outburst, in her first gay press interview!



Many were deeply offended by Kate's anti-gay comments last week, and plenty just didn't care. We thought best to set the record straight (pardon the pun), and see if the BB evictee really would fall ill at the sight of two guys kissing. Kate was actually excited to talk with queerplanet, in her first gay press interview, and so were we!

queerplanet: Now Kate, since the homophobic outburst, there's been ?Hate Kate? campaigns, anti-Kate polls and a lot of negative talk amongst the Australian gay community ? how did that make you feel?

Kate: I was actually really hurt and really upset, but no fault of anybody's but my own. I don't know how to express how sorry I was, because the fact is I am not homophobic, and I never have been. And it was just a situation where I had two of my closest mates, both heterosexual, who were dared by BB as such. We wrote the dares, but they got turned around.

queerplanet: You made an apology on Monday night's Nominations Show, what sort of role did your publicist and producers play in prepping that?

Kate: I didn't even know that it was even going to be asked. They had no role in preparation for any of that. When I first came out, Carmel had told me what had happened.

queerplanet: In the viewers eye, obviously it's difficult to believe an apology after saying one thing, and then totally changing opinion, in what context did ?I'm a homophobic?, not actually mean ?I'm a homophobic??

Kate: I don't know why I said it, I was just so off put. I was even kissing girls in the house. One of my good friends, Geneva, is bisexual.

queerplanet: A lot of people have a bad impression of you now, do you blame Big Brother for not showing the entire conversation?

Kate: No I can't blame BB, because the thing is, they cant fabricate anything that I have said. It would have been nice if people could have seen before, middle and after ? not just the middle, but that's just the way it goes. I cant be a sourpuss in that way at all.

queerplanet: You also mentioned you had some close gay friends, male and female, have you had a chance to speak with them, or do you know what their reaction was?

Kate: Yeah, and thing was, of course they told me I was an idiot, but they weren't hurt. They know that I'm not [homophobic].

queerplanet: Do you think all the negative press you have received, since the comments were made, was warranted? Or was it hyped up for the sake of a good story?

Kate: This is really hard, I cant express how sorry I am. If I have caused any hurt or any pain to anybody, then I deserve whatever comes my way. So at the same time I'm not going to turn around and go ?poor me?.

queerplanet: Do you think the bad press will affect any possible opportunities for the future with your new found fame?

Kate: I hope not, I don't think it will. I think that anyone who actually knows me, and they would have to if they want me to be involved in any public forum for them, I don't think it will.
